1 Mix components and adjust pH to 7.0. Bring to a boil and cool down under a N2-CO2 (4:1, v/v) gas stream. Distribute the medium into culture vessels under the same gas mixture, seal with butyl rubber stoppers and autoclave. After cooling, aseptically and anaerobically add per liter the following solutions (autoclaved or *filter-sterilized): | |||||
|
Sodium lactate
(1 M) |
20.00 | ml | ||
|
NaHCO3
(*, 5%) |
40.00 | ml | ||
2 Prior to use, add per liter the following solution to reduce the medium (autoclaved and stored under N2): | |||||
|
Na2S x 9 H2O
(5%) |
8.00 | ml |
